The page code in the example site makes use of a variable mgdroot which
seems to be set somewhere such that it automatically contains the base
url of the site. I know very well that this is much different from the
DocumentRoot in httpd.conf (my images are fetched from there). My
problem is that my $mgdroot appears to be empty.
In fact, <? &(mgdroot) ?> outputs nothing at all.

As a result, relative links do work, but things like

 href="&(mgdroot);/somename.html"

don't.

I am sure that I am missing something. I am also pretty sure that I am
not supposed to set mgdroot myself, because this would go against the
Midgard philosophy.

I searched this list, but I couldn't get any enlightenment.

Is my problem related to active/static pages?
